“…From this figure, it can be seen that the spectrum due to each heartbeat appears in the frequency band higher than 2 Hz. Specifically, in our preliminary research [23], we have confirmed that the frequency components due to the heartbeat are mainly distributed from 8.0 Hz to 30 Hz. To associate features of the heartbeat signal with those of the ECG signal, the heartbeat components in such a high frequency band are essential.…”

“…Some conventional methods estimate the HR based on frequency analysis by (i) Fast Fourier Transform (FFT) [10][11], (ii) Wavelet Transform (WT) [12][13], (iii) Multiple Signal Classification (MUSIC) [14] [15], and DCT [16]. In contrast, by detecting a heartbeat signal over the signal obtained through the extended signal processing, the conventional methods [17]- [23] estimate the BBI. Experimental results have shown that these conventional methods have achieved high HR and BBI estimation accuracies.…”
